Does my waste get recycled?

When you rent a temporary dumpster, your goal is to fill it up and possess the waste hauled away. But if you'd like your waste recycled, you may have to go about it in a slightly different style. Waste in the majority of temporary dumpsters isn't recycled because the containers are so big and hold so much material.

If you're interested in recycling any waste from your job, check into getting smaller containers. Many Dumpster Rental companies in Lenox have a wide variety of containers available, including those for recycling. All these are typically smaller than temporary dumpsters; they're the size of regular trash bins and smaller.

If you'd like to recycle, find out if the business you're working with uses single stream recycling (you don't have to sort the substance) or in case you'll need to form the recyclable material into distinct containers (aluminum cans, cardboard, plastics, etc.) This will make a difference in the number of containers you need to rent.

Permanent vs Roll off dumpsters

Whether or not you desire a long-term or roll off dumpster is dependent upon the kind of job and service you will need. Long-Lasting dumpster service is for continuing needs that continue more than just a few days. This includes things like day-to-day waste and recycling needs. Temporary service is exactly what the name indicates; a one-time need for job-special waste removal.

Temporary roll-off dumpsters are delivered on a truck and are rolled off where they will be utilized. These are generally bigger containers that could manage all the waste which is included with that specific job. Long-Lasting dumpsters are generally smaller containers since they're emptied on a regular basis and so don't need to hold as much at one time.

If you request a long-term dumpster, some companies need at least a one-year service agreement for this dumpster. Roll off dumpsters only require a rental fee for the time that you just maintain the dumpster on the job.

Deciding Where to Place Your Dumpster

Deciding where to place your dumpster can get a huge effect on how fast you complete endeavors. The most effective option is to select a place that is close to the worksite. It is vital, however, to consider whether this place is a safe alternative. Make sure that the place is free of barriers that could trip individuals while they take heavy debris.

A lot of individuals decide to set dumpsters in their own driveways. It is a convenient alternative since it usually means you can avoid asking the city for a license or permit. In the event you need to set the dumpster on the street, then you should contact your local government to inquire whether you are required to get a permit. Although many municipalities will let people keep dumpsters on the road for short levels of time, others are going to request that you fill out some paperwork. Following these rules will help you stay away from fines that will make your job more expensive.

What is the biggest size dumpster accessible?

The biggest roll-off dumpster that businesses generally rent is a 40 yard container. This huge dumpster will hold up to 40 cubic yards of debris, which is equal to between 12 and 20 pickup truck loads of debris.

The weight limitation on 40 yard containers usually ranges from 4 to 8 tons (8,000 to 16,000 pounds). Be really aware of the limitation and do your best not to surpass it. If you do go over the limit, you can incur overage charges, which add up quickly.

Examples of projects that a 40 yard container will likely be the perfect size for contain: A foreclosure or estate cleanout A 750 square foot deck removal 4,000 square feet of roofing shingles in multiple layers Whole-dwelling interior renovation Getting rid of junk when you are moving in or out House demolition New house construction Commercial and residential cleanouts


What Types of Debris Can I Place Into a Dumpster?

You can place most forms of debris into a Dumpster Rental in Lenox. There are, nevertheless, some exclusions. For instance, you cannot place chemicals into a dumpster. That includes motor oil, paints, solvents, automotive fluids, pesticides, and cleaning agents. Electronics and batteries are also prohibited. If something introduces an environmental risk, you probably cannot put it in a dumpster. Contact your rental business if you're uncertain.

That makes most varieties of debris that you can put in the dumpster, contain drywall, concrete, lumber, and yard waste. Pretty much any sort of debris left from a construction job can go in the dumpster.

Particular types of acceptable debris, nevertheless, may require additional fees. In the event you plan to throw away used tires, mattresses, or appliances, you need to request the rental business whether you need to pay another fee. Adding these to your dumpster may cost anywhere from $25 to $100, depending on the thing.
